Chevrolet Cobalt Service & Repair Manual: Rear Compartment Lid Latch
Removal
| 1. |
Release lock rod using a flat-bladed
tool. |
| 2. |
Disconnect electrical connector if
equipped. |
| 3. |
Remove rear compartment latch bolts
(2), Fig. 1. |
| 4. |
Remove latch (3) through access hole. |
|
Installation
| 1. |
Install latch through access hole,
Fig. 1. |
| 2. |
Install rear compartment latch bolts.
Torque to 89 inch lbs. |
| 3. |
Install electrical connector if equipped,
to latch. |
|
